What is Active Adult Living?
Active adult communities are designed for individuals 55+ who want to enjoy the freedom of retirement living without the need for daily care services. Residents live independently in thoughtfully designed apartments or cottages, surrounded by neighbors in the same stage of life.
With access to amenities, fitness opportunities, and social events, active adult living makes it easy to focus on wellness, connection, and the activities you love without the hassle of household upkeep.
What is Independent Living?
Independent living is designed for active adults who want to enjoy a maintenance-free lifestyle with access to amenities, social events, and opportunities to pursue new interests. It allows residents to live fully on their own terms, free from the responsibilities of home upkeep.
What is Assisted Living?
Assisted living provides the perfect balance between independence and support. Residents maintain as much freedom as possible while receiving help with daily tasks such as bathing, dressing, mobility, or medication management. It’s designed to provide peace of mind, knowing care is available whenever it’s needed.
What is Memory Care?
Memory care services offer specialized support for individuals living with Alzheimer’s, dementia, or other forms of memory loss. Our neighborhoods are intentionally designed for safety and engagement, with caregivers trained to provide personalized attention and purpose-driven programming that helps residents embrace every moment.
What is a Short-Term Stay?
Short-term stays or respite care are temporary stays in a senior living community. They are a great option for recovery after a hospital visit, giving a caregiver time to rest, or simply trying out community life before making a permanent move. Guests enjoy all the same programs, services, and amenities as full-time residents.

How Much Does Senior Living Cost?
The cost of senior living varies depending on the level of care, type of apartment, and community location. Many services, such as dining, housekeeping, maintenance, and lifestyle programming, are included in the monthly rate. Our Integrated Senior Lifestyles team will walk you through pricing and help you explore financial options that fit your needs.
What Financial Resources Are Available?
Several programs may help offset the cost of senior living, including:
- Elderlife Financial Services for flexible planning solutions.
- Veterans Benefits for those who have served.
- Tax Benefits that may apply to medical or care-related expenses.
When is the Best Time to Move into a Senior Living Community?
The best time to consider a move is before a crisis arises. If daily tasks feel overwhelming, home safety is a concern, or social opportunities are limited, a senior living community can provide the right balance of support and independence while offering opportunities to connect, engage, and thrive.

How Can I Help My Loved One Adjust?
The transition can be emotional, but there are steps to make it easier:
- Visit the community together before move-in.
- Personalize the new space with favorite belongings.
- Stay involved in daily life, from meals to activities.
- Give grace and time. Adjusting is a process.
